Regulatory Landscape and Compliance

The regulatory environment in Australia is a critical consideration for any player in the online gambling market. The Interactive Gambling Act 2001 (IGA) forms the cornerstone of online gambling regulation, prohibiting the provision of certain online gambling services to Australian residents. However, the IGA has been subject to ongoing review and interpretation, leading to a complex and sometimes ambiguous regulatory landscape. State and territory governments also play a significant role, with each jurisdiction having its own licensing and enforcement mechanisms. Compliance with these regulations is paramount, and non-compliance can result in severe penalties, including fines, license revocation, and reputational damage. Industry analysts must stay abreast of legislative changes, regulatory updates, and enforcement actions to assess the risks and opportunities associated with operating in the Australian market. Understanding the nuances of responsible gambling measures, anti-money laundering (AML) regulations, and data privacy requirements is also crucial. Regular audits, legal reviews, and engagement with regulatory bodies are essential for maintaining compliance and mitigating potential risks.
